What's It Like to Live in Playa El Rompio, Panama?
Playa El Rompio is 10-15 minutes from Chitre, Panama, on the eastern Azuero Peninsula. Compared to other beach communities in Panama, the eastern Azuero has very affordable prices. Jamie shares his experiences, the costs of living at Playa El Rompio, and what it has to offer... including really good fishing!
